About The Position

To serve as a Manufacturing Supervisor by leading and motivating manufacturing teams, driving operational excellence through lean daily management, and leveraging data-driven decision-making to achieve and exceed production goals. This role is responsible for implementing process improvements, executing change initiatives, and effectively managing labor resources to enhance efficiency, quality, and safety. With a proven track record in lean methodologies and manufacturing leadership, the supervisor will foster a culture of continuous improvement and accountability, ensuring the organization remains agile, responsive, and competitive in a dynamic production environment.

Requirements

  • Hgh school diploma or equivalent required.
  • Leadership Excellence: a strong passion and commitment to inspiring and mentoring team members, the ability to handle complex situations, execute with urgency, and deliver on commitments and meet deadlines.
  • Lean Expertise: comprehensive experience with Lean principles and advanced application of tools (e.g., VSM, Process Mapping, 6S, Kaizen).
  • Advanced Business Acumen: demonstrated ability to leverage data for strategic decision-making and implementation of continuous improvement.
  • Change Leadership: proven track record in leading and sustaining significant change and process improvements initiatives.
  • Technical Proficiency: advanced skills in Microsoft PowerPoint, and Excel for data analysis and presentation.
  • Applicants must be authorized to work for ANY employer in the U.S. We are unable to sponsor or take over sponsorship of an employment Visa at this time.

Nice To Haves

  • BA/BS degree in a technical or business-related field strongly preferred.

Responsibilities

  • Oversee and manage daily manufacturing operations, ensuring production schedules, quality, and safety standards are consistently met or exceeded.
  • Lead and mentor manufacturing teams, fostering a culture of engagement, continuous improvement, and accountability.
  • Execute lean daily management practices, driving the application of lean methodologies across all operations to eliminate waste and streamline processes.
  • Identify strategic process improvements by leveraging data and analytics and implement change initiatives that enhance efficiency and quality.
  • Effectively manage labor and resource allocation, ensuring optimal staffing and operational performance.
  • Monitor production metrics and key performance indicators (KPIs) to identify areas for improvement and initiate corrective actions as needed.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ams—including quality, engineering, and supply chain—to support manufacturing goals and drive operational excellence.
  • Ensure compliance with safety regulations and company policies, maintaining a safe work environment for all team members.
  • Communicate performance updates, challenges, and successes to senior leadership, providing clear insights that support business-critical decision-making.
